Kind of funny to me that people complain about the inner hairs collapsing over the hole: that is by design! You don't need to cut them away. Just put your hand over the entire brush and it's obvious what the design is. Horse hairs are like polite strangers in a crowd: they don't clump, they keep a wonderful kind of distance from each other, small though it is, and the result in a brush like this is that the entire area of horse hairs turns into a low-pressure zone that sucks in dust. The hairs dislodge dust and the dust gets pulled into the breathing matrix. The collapse of the hair closest to the holes is necessary to allow the vacuum effect to spread through the entire zone of horse hairs. This is a diffuser, not a scraper. If you want a brush with a central "tube" of vacuuming with stiff bristles around it but not creating that kind of wonderful zone, there are plenty of attachments like that, and I have some. They're great for what they're great for. This is wonderful for what it is great at: creating an excellent fist-size zone of low pressure that pulls in dust in a way that is even throughout that zone. I gave up thinking that one or two attachments were enough. Once I got into cleaning the dust I noticed that the reason there are many different kinds of attachments is that each one has its strengths and weaknesses, but the idea is to have enough attachments so that the real strengths of each is available when I need it. I just came back to add this: I also ordered some attachments of the type that has synthetic, almost wiry, bristles around a central opening that has the tube behind it. That's a different kind of attachment - it scrapes away at the surface just a bit and pulls things into the tube. It's great, but it's not the horsehair thing where the central hairs collapse over and into the hole which causes the vacuum pressure to enter the entire matrix of horsehair, which is great for particular kinds of dust and also it doesn't pull in small objects. they're stopped by the hair. It's a wonderful, specific thing. Just get at least one of each and you'll realize the point and benefit of the floppy horsehair one. If I had a bunch of shattered pieces to vacuum up, for example, I wouldn't use this attachment, not even close, but if I want to gently vacuum an air filter or an area that has a lot of dust, but I don't want violent vacuuming potentially ripping or tearing something, I use this because it is very gentle yet very even and effective. The short horse hairs that act like bristles on the floor attachment, for example, scrape the floor to dislodge dust and things that have somewhat adhered, so it provides a kind of "scrubbing". This is not for that. This is for pulling in fine dust that can move between the hairs and it is gentle enough to do that without any violence to items that can't withstand direct vacuum suction from a powerful machine. Basically, as I said, this is a diffuser that spreads out the vacuum effect within a roughly fist-sized space while more or less caressing the surface without damaging it. I find it important to take it off after I'm done and use the open end of the vacuum tube to vacuum this brush vigorously. Some dust can be fuzz of various types, and they can get stuck, so I have to run the vacuum through this brush back and forth to dislodge and pull in those various potential things that would eventually block the flow of air.

Real Horsehair is SUPERIOR to anything else
I have recently bought three of this exact vacuum cleaner dusting brushes and can report to potential buyers that they are a first class dusting brush. What makes this a good brush is that the horsehair bristles are 1 1/2 inches long, nice and soft so that they will not scratch delicate finishes of good furniture. Also the design of the brush is ideal, without long extensions that put the brush at awkward angle when vacuuming. IMPORTANT is that the connection point of this brush is a measured 1 3/8 inch INSIDE diameter, so you need to measure your connection piece to be certain that it fits. I’m using this brush on a Miele model C1 vacuum. The “mouth of this brush is actually too small to fit my connection tube, BUT that mouth is made of flexible material, not plastic, which has allowed me to stretch the mouth and fit it to the connection tube. I store it connected to the tube which over time is stretching it to fit my vacuum. If you have a Miele C1 you can do the same. That vacuum cleaner is the best by far that I have ever encountered.

Excellent Replacement Brush
Some brushes, particularly those for shop vacuums, use nylon or other synthetic brush materials. While they're durable, they aren't as good at picking up dust or fine particulates. This natural horse hair does a great job on both coarse and fine cleaning and at a very reasonable price. Product arrived well packaged and on-time from the seller.
